سورس و کد نرم افزار ثبت اطلاعات فیلم
دانلود سورس کد نرم افزار ثبت اطلاعات فیلم در سی شارپ با دیتابیس اکسس
در دنیای برنامهنویسی، ساخت نرمافزارهای مدیریت اطلاعات، یکی از نیازهای اساسی و پرکاربرد است که بسیاری از توسعهدهندگان در پی پیادهسازی آن هستند. یکی از نمونههای عملی و قابل استفاده، نرمافزار ثبت اطلاعات فیلم است که با زبان برنامهنویسی سیشارپ (C#) و پایگاه داده اکسس (Access) توسعه یافته است. این نرمافزار نه تنها به عنوان یک پروژه آموزشی مفید، بلکه به عنوان یک ابزار عملی برای ثبت، ویرایش، حذف و جستجوی اطلاعات فیلمها در سیستمهای کوچک و متوسط کاربرد دارد.
در ادامه، قصد دارم به صورت جامع و کامل، تمامی جنبههای مربوط به این پروژه، از جمله ساختار کلی، قسمتهای مختلف، نحوه اتصال به پایگاه داده، و نکات مهم در توسعه و بهبود آن، توضیح دهم. این توضیحات برای کسانی که قصد دارند این پروژه را دانلود، درک و یا توسعه دهند، بسیار مفید و راهگشا خواهد بود.
ساختار کلی پروژه
در ابتدا، باید بدانید که این پروژه از چند بخش اصلی تشکیل شده است. این بخشها عبارتند از:
- پروژه ویندوز فرم (Windows Forms Application): این بخش، رابط کاربری است که کاربر با آن تعامل دارد. طراحی فرمها، کنترلها، و نحوه نمایش اطلاعات، در این قسمت انجام میشود.
- پایگاه داده اکسس (.mdb): این فایل، محل ذخیرهسازی اطلاعات فیلمها است. ساختار پایگاه داده شامل جدولهایی است که فیلدهای مربوط به هر فیلم را نگهداری میکنند.
- کدهای برنامه (C#): بخش منطق برنامه است که عملیاتهای افزودن، ویرایش، حذف و جستجو را مدیریت میکند.
طراحی پایگاه داده اکسس
یکی از ابتداییترین مراحل، طراحی پایگاه داده است. در این پروژه، یک جدول به نام `Movies` ساخته میشود که فیلدهای زیر را دارد:
- `ID`: شماره منحصر به فرد هر فیلم (کلید اصلی)
- `Title`: عنوان فیلم
- `Director`: کارگردان فیلم
- `Year`: سال تولید
- `Genre`: ژانر فیلم
- `Rating`: امتیاز فیلم
این ساختار ساده و در عین حال کارآمد، امکان ثبت کامل اطلاعات هر فیلم را فراهم میآورد. بعد از طراحی، فایل `.mdb` باید در مسیر پروژه قرار گیرد، یا در صورت نیاز در مسیر مشخصی ذخیره شود.
اتصال برنامه به پایگاه داده
در سیشارپ، برای اتصال به فایل اکسس، باید از کلاس `OleDbConnection` استفاده کرد. برای این کار، رشته اتصال (Connection String) مناسب باید تهیه شود. نمونهای از رشته اتصال است:
csharp
string connectionString = @"Provider=Microsoft.Jet.OLEDB.- 0;Data Source=path_to_your_mdb_file.mdb;";
در اینجا، `path_to_your_mdb_file.mdb` باید مسیر کامل فایل پایگاه داده باشد. این رشته، ارتباط برنامه با پایگاه داده را برقرار میکند، و از آن پس، عملیاتهایی مانند درج، ویرایش، حذف و جستجو، با استفاده از دستورات SQL انجام میشود.
عملیاتهای اصلی در برنامه
در این پروژه، چند عملیات مهم وجود دارد که باید به درستی پیادهسازی شوند:
۱. افزودن اطلاعات فیلم
برای افزودن یک فیلم جدید، یک فرم طراحی میشود که کاربر بتواند اطلاعات را وارد کند. پس از کلیک بر دکمه “اضافه کردن”، برنامه با استفاده از دستور SQL ... ← ادامه مطلب در magicfile.ir
باکس دانلود ( سورس و کد نرم افزار ثبت اطلاعات فیلم)
دانلود
پیشنهاد برای دانلود ( سورس و کد نرم افزار ثبت اطلاعات فیلم )
نظرات کاربران (۳)
مریم احمدی
عالی بود .. با تشکر